I just noticed a decent solution to this by accident. My android broke, hard, and I had to get a replacement. The automatic backup that Google provides restored everything I needed, and pretty quickly, on the new phone. I think I was only missing call history, which I can live without.
So, at least for me, the current tech provides all I need. Just do a factory wipe before I leave for the airport, and restore it after I'm past the goon squad.
